DRS Investment SE
DRS Investment SE is a multi-family office based in Germany, focusing on direct investments in established software companies. Founded by Dr. Andreas Spiegel in 2017, it pools capital from entrepreneurial families to facilitate private equity investments.

DRS Investment SE as a funder
Investment thesis
DRS Investment SE focuses on direct investments in stable and established software companies, targeting niche players with sustainable earnings.
Focus narrative
DRS Investment specializes in investing in stable and established software companies, particularly those with an EBIT between €0.5 million and €3.0 million. The organization targets niche players with their own products or unique service offerings, emphasizing sustainable and stable earnings. DRS does not invest in startups or provide growth capital for companies in the loss zone.

Portfolio context
Notable portfolio companies include Aurena GmbH, which operates an auction platform for used goods; the factory Group, providing AI-enhanced production for marketing content; MarkStein, a leader in publishing technology; EvaSys, a provider of survey software solutions; and XELOG AG, a warehouse management solutions company.
